During the meeting, Scindia highlighted the exclusive presence of Airbus aircraft in IndiGo’s fleet, emphasising the country’s growing aviation sector. In a post on X, he expressed the intent to further collaborate on aircraft manufacturing and designing initiatives. Recognising India’s status as one of the world’s fastest-growing economies and its commitment to ‘Make In India,’ Scindia emphasised the enormous potential for the nation to emerge as a global aircraft manufacturing hub.
With India’s civil aviation market experiencing rapid growth, the discussions between Scindia and Faury reflect the mutual interest in fostering long-term partnerships. The focus on collaboration aligns with India’s aspirations to strengthen its aerospace capabilities and contribute significantly to the global aviation manufacturing landscape.
